LAYYAH, July 3: A Lahore-to-Layyah bus hit a patrolling police van near Chaubara on Tuesday, leaving an assistant sub-inspector (ASI) and three constables dead at the scene.
Eyewitness told Dawn the police van carrying ASI Nazar Abbas, Driver Abdul Majeed, constables M Rasheed Shakir and Shahzada Khuram, all from the Kapuri Patrolling Police Check Post, had been parked along the road to check a timber laden tractor-trolley. In the meantime, the rashly driven bus collided head on with the van dragging it 80 yards from the collision point. All the occupants of the police van died instantly. The bodies of Majeed and Nazar could be retrieved by cutting the door of the van. The driver escaped from the scene.
